COURSE OVERVIEW


Our Overhead Crane & Rigging Level 1 course is developed with the latest overhead crane regulations, applicable ASME rigging standards, and over five decades of operator experience. The course covers the correct operation, usage, and inspection of overhead cranes and rigging.

Upon successful completion of the Overhead Crane & Rigging Level 1 course, assessment forms will be provided for non-biased evaluation of worker competency.
